    Turnstile is an innovative platform for quote-to-cash automation specifically tailored for SaaS businesses, simplifying and automating every step of the revenue lifecycle, from initial quoting and subscription oversight to billing, collections, and revenue acknowledgment. By consolidating what has typically been a patchwork of spreadsheets and various finance tools into a single cohesive system, it enables teams to generate polished, customizable quotes that clients can easily view, approve, and pay without the need for PDFs or login credentials. Additionally, subscriptions are automatically activated once agreements are signed, and it adeptly manages complex pricing structures—be they recurring, usage-based, tiered, or hybrid—without requiring manual intervention. Turnstile's integration with CRM systems and payment processors ensures that deal terms seamlessly transition into real-time subscription and billing processes, while also assisting teams in monitoring renewals and payment statuses, ultimately producing precise revenue reports and dashboards without the burden of additional reconciliation tasks.
